Pasadena Congressman, Young Angelenos Urge Community to Wear Masks In New PSA

In Video, Schiff and constituents under 35 explain why masks and social distancing are important

Rep. Adam Schiff (D-Pasadena) released a video on Tuesday urging all Angelenos to wear masks in public in order to slow the spread of coronavirus and save lives.

The public service announcement, which highlights new data on rising Coronavirus infections in people under age 35, features videos of young people throughout California’s 28th District explaining why they wear masks and practice social distancing.

“This pandemic is not over,” Schiff said in the video. “It is not over. And when we act like it is, we endanger the lives of everyone around us. Wearing a mask and social distancing are the best ways to keep you safe, your family safe, and members of your community safe – and ensure that we can reopen our economy sooner. Simply put, masks work. Masks save lives. If we want to beat this virus, Americans need to get serious about wearing masks whenever we’re out in public.”

Across the country, states are experiencing a surge in new coronavirus cases, especially among young people. In California, people under the age of 35 make up nearly half of new COVID-19 cases. According to public health experts, wearing a mask can significantly reduce the transmission of coronavirus between individuals.

The Los Angeles County Department of Public Health reported 2,593 new detected infections and 13 new deaths on Monday. The county has seen 136,129 COVID-19 cases and 3,822 deaths, in all as of Monday.

In Pasadena, health officials reported 27 new infections and no new deaths on Monday, city spokeswoman Lisa Derderian said.

The city has recorded 1,544 COVID-19 cases in all, and 100 deaths. Fifty-four COVID-19 patients were being treated at Huntington Hospital, according to hospital data.
